Subject: [PATCH v7 3/9] drm/vc4: hdmi: Take into account the clock doubling flag in atomic_check

Commit 63495f6b4aed ("drm/vc4: hdmi: Make sure our clock rate is within
limits") was intended to compute the pixel rate to make sure we remain
within the boundaries of what the hardware can provide.
However, unlike what mode_valid was checking for, we forgot to take
into account the clock doubling flag that can be set for modes. Let's
honor that flag if it's there.

drivers/gpu/drm/vc4/vc4_hdmi.c | 3 +++
1 file changed, 3 insertions(+)
di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/vc4/vc4_hdmi.c b/drivers/gpu/drm/vc4/vc4_hdmi.c
index 8ce5dd65f6e4..3dac839b0fa5 100644
--- a/drivers/gpu/drm/vc4/vc4_hdmi.c
+++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/vc4/vc4_hdmi.c
@@ -799,6 +799,9 @@ static int vc4_hdmi_encoder_atomic_check(struct drm_encoder *encoder,
pixel_rate = mode->clock * 1000;
}
+ if (mode->flags & DRM_MODE_FLAG_DBLCLK)
+ pixel_rate = pixel_rate * 2;
+
if (pixel_rate > vc4_hdmi->variant->max_pixel_clock)
return -EINVAL;
